When searching for a basketball gym near you to rent, there are several factors to consider to ensure you find the perfect facility that meets your needs and preferences.

Location

The location of the gym is a crucial aspect to consider when renting a basketball gym near you. A convenient location can save you time and money on transportation. Ideally, the gym should be close to your home, work, or within a reasonable driving distance. It is also essential to consider the surrounding area, such as the proximity to schools, parks, or shopping centers. Having a gym in a safe and accessible area can help reduce anxiety and make it easier to get in and out of the facility.

Accessibility

In addition to the location, you should also consider the accessibility of the gym. This includes the parking area, entrance, and interior spaces. Ensure that the gym has sufficient parking space for your vehicles and that the entrance is easily accessible for individuals with disabilities. Furthermore, the interior spaces should be clean, well-maintained, and provide a comfortable environment for playing and practicing.

Facility Quality

The quality of the facility is another critical aspect to consider when renting a basketball gym near you. Look for a gym that has a well-maintained floor, adequate lighting, and sufficient ventilation. The facility should also have a clean and hygienic environment, with regular cleaning and maintenance schedules. A gym with a high-quality facility can provide a better overall experience and reduce the risk of injury.

Equipment Availability

The availability of equipment is essential for a basketball gym. Ensure that the gym has a range of equipment available, including basketball hoops, backboards, and ball return systems. The equipment should be in good working condition and regularly maintained to ensure optimal performance. Additionally, consider the availability of training aids, such as rebounding machines and strength training equipment.

Pricing

The pricing of the gym is a significant factor to consider when renting a basketball gym near you. Compare prices among different gyms in your area to find the most affordable option. Consider not only the hourly or monthly fee but also any additional costs, such as equipment rental or facility maintenance fees. A gym with competitive pricing can help you save money and allocate resources to other essential expenses.

Contract Terms

Before signing a contract with a gym, carefully review the terms and conditions. Understand the length of the agreement, any cancellation fees, and the process for terminating the contract. Ensure that the contract includes provisions for payment, maintenance, and equipment usage. A comprehensive contract can help protect your interests and reduce the risk of disputes.

Creating a Budget for Renting a Basketball Gym Near You

Renting a basketball gym near you can be a cost-effective way to improve your team’s skills and performance, but it’s essential to create a budget that covers all the expenses involved. A well-planned budget will help you make the most of your rental and avoid unnecessary costs.

Breaking Down Estimated Costs

When creating a budget for renting a basketball gym, it’s crucial to consider both recurring and one-time expenses. Recurring expenses include facility fees, equipment rental, and staff supervision, while one-time expenses may include setup costs, cleaning fees, or any special requirements.

To break down the estimated costs, categorize them into the following:

* Facility fees: This includes the cost of renting the gym, typically on an hourly or daily basis. The cost will vary depending on the location, size, and amenities of the gym.
* Equipment rental: This includes the cost of renting basketball hoops, balls, and other equipment necessary for a game or practice.
* Staff supervision: This includes the cost of hiring a coach, trainer, or referee to oversee the activities in the gym.
* One-time expenses: This includes any additional costs associated with renting the gym, such as setup costs, cleaning fees, or any special requirements.
